Sales Lead for Network Marketing



What is a sales lead for network marketing? In my opinion, a sales lead for network marketing can be any of the following:

• Someone interested in joining your business opportunity

• Someone who filled out a web-form or survey expressing interest in starting a home-based business

• Someone who responded to one of your advertisements

• Someone interested in purchasing your products and/or services

You can generate your own sales leads or you can purchase leads from a lead company. Although I am a little bit biased, I believe that you should create your own leads. That way, you don’t have to share your leads with other people. Simply put, your leads will be exclusive to you.

Where to Get Leads

Where can you get a sales lead for network marketing? There are many different ways to generate these types of leads. Listed below are four of my favorite ways to generate my own leads.

Newspaper Advertising: This is my favorite way to generate sales leads for my network marketing business. I believe all network marketers should start building their business locally. To do so, you can write a short ad and place it in your local newspaper. You can have people call you, visit a website, or call a toll-free number and listen to a pre-recorded message. It’s really simple and cheap. For instance, I just placed a 30-day advertisement in my local newspaper for $168. That’s about $5.50 per day.

Pay-Per-Click Ads: This is the FASTEST ways to generate leads. You can write up a short ad and place in on the popular search engines such as Google®, Bing® and Yahoo®. When people click on your ad, they will be redirected to your website. Your key to success is to have persuasive sales copy that sparks enough interest with your visitor, so they will leave you their contact information or request more information. Also, you don’t want to pay too much per click. It’s best to start low (ten to thirty cents per click) and test your results.

Social Media: Websites such as MySpace® and Facebook® are an awesome place to get leads. Facebook®, for example, has more than 500 million users. You can visit the various network marketing groups or home-based business groups and strike up conversations with people. You can also chat with your friends. Most people have at least 200 friends on Facebook®.

Post-Card Marketing: Direct Mail is one of the most effective lead generation techniques available. And it is one of the most underutilized. You should consider promoting your MLM business via direct mail. To get started, you can purchase a lead list. Your key to success is to get a “targeted list.” Once you have your list, you need to generate a short sales letter than can be placed on a postcard. Finally, you must mail the postcards. When people respond to your ads with requests for more information, you simply follow up with them, answer their questions, and help them get started.

Final Thoughts

In conclusion, a sales lead for network marketing is someone who is interested in starting their own home-based business or someone looking to buy your products and/or services. You can either purchase your leads from a lead company or generate your own sales lead for network marketing. I’ve found that most of the top earners generate their own leads. I think you should do the same.
